The romantic
Charlotte’s continues to be a favorite habitué for notable celebrities and locals who enjoy the privacy
and charm of this intimate restaurant.
Originally comprised of four cottages surrouding a trellis-covered
patio, this season Charlotte’s adds the new Salon
Rouge, a larger dining room directly accessible from historic
La Plaza’s parking area. Deep refd walls are set off
by gilt mirrors and antique tables with windows swathed
in sunny yellow silk – perfect for sipping champagne
and devouring decadent desserts, or entertaining up to 45
guests.
The other three delightful dining rooms,
each with a fireplace and named for owner Charlotte Solomon’s
grandchildren, are eclectically decorated with antiques,
mixed-and-matched chairs, china, glass and silverware.
The fourth bungalow is the kitchen.
The William Room is painted fatigue green with magenta accents.
Jaden’s room is apple green and peach and Alyssa’s
is dutch blue and white, patterned after favorite china. |

All are tied together with gilt-framed artwork and
mirrors, plants, soft sconce lighting and French doors that open
to the shaded patio.
Flower-laden bougainvillea and green shuters with palm tree and
star cutouts contrast rustic adobe walls.
Lunch includes soups, salads, sandwiches, juicy hamburgers, Shrimp
Pasta and others entrées. Lunchtime slowly melts into late
afternoons where teatime may be enjoyed by reservations only. Light
fare such as cheese boards, fresh fruit platters and soups are available
late afternoons and late evening. Dinner, then, is merely a whisper
of linen, link of wine glasses and the soft stains of jazz before
sumptuous fragrances from the kitchen signal that repasts of soups,
pastas, seafood and more are in the works.
Open daily during the season, Charlotte’s serves lunch from
11 a.m. to 3 p.m., afternoon tea from 2-4 p.m. by reservation only
and dinner from 5 to 10 p.m. Lunch an dinner reservations are recommended.
